Mathematical Yaw Calibration: Standard 0.022 Constant

PEAK utilizes the industry-standard 0.022 degrees per count yaw multiplier, providing seamless 1:1 compatibility with Source engine and standard first-person titles:

Exact Sensitivity Conversion Ratios for PEAK: - From Apex Legends: PEAK Sens = Apex Sens (1:1 Direct Match) - From CS2: PEAK Sens = CS2 Sens (1:1 Direct Match) - From Valorant: PEAK Sens = Valorant Sens ร— 3.1818 - From Overwatch 2: PEAK Sens = Overwatch 2 Sens ร— 0.3000 - From Fortnite: PEAK Sens = Fortnite Sens ร— 0.2525

Quick Reference Conversion Table at 800 DPI

cm/360 Distance Apex Legends (800 DPI) Valorant (800 DPI) PEAK Sens (800 DPI) PEAK (1600 DPI)
32.0 cm/360 (High Agility)1.620.5091.620.81
40.0 cm/360 (Balanced)1.300.4081.300.65
51.9 cm/360 (Tac Standard)1.000.3141.000.50
60.0 cm/360 (Precision)0.8660.2720.8660.433

Grapple Reorientation & High-Angle Vertical Aiming

Because grappling swings require rapid 180-degree turnarounds to anchor safety lines onto cliff walls, running at moderate-to-high sensitivity (32cm to 42cm per 360) is recommended. Pairing this with an XL mousepad (500ร—500mm) gives you ample vertical swipe clearance.

How do I convert my Apex Legends sensitivity to PEAK?

Because both games use a 0.022 yaw multiplier, your Apex Legends in-game sensitivity translates 1:1 directly into PEAK at the same DPI.

Does PEAK support raw mouse input?

Yes. PEAK supports native raw mouse input on PC, ensuring zero pointer acceleration or smoothing from Windows.
